Not sure, but the optimizer existed before the new minimum cpc changes were implemented so I guess it doesnt take that into account.

My guess is that it disabled a high cost keyword, in order to have more clicks on lower costing keywords.

It maximise the total clicks your account get I recon, but not maximising the total click a keyword gets.
